TURN-208: Gatevale turnstile counters at the Merrow Field pilot double-count when a rotation reverses mid-cycle. Attendance totals drift roughly 2% high per event. The debounce window fix is implemented, reviewed by Ilsa, and soak-tested across two simulated match days without drift. Ready for your cut; the candidate build is identified below.

trace token, tagag-tafog: htk6_5ed18c

The Orvane Labs bike cage and the east and west parking gates operate on separate access schedules, and facilities desk staff should note that visitor vehicles may only use the west gate between 07:00 and 19:00. Cyclists requesting cage access must show a valid day pass, and their details should be entered in the access ledger before the cage is opened. Gates must never be propped open, even briefly, during deliveries. When a manual override is required at either gate, use the code below.

staff pass of fadup-fawig = bdg-FUNKS-4

Finance Review Summary — Branch Managers, Caldermere Savings Group

The Lanwick pilot recorded customer churn of 7.2% over the quarter, above the 5% threshold we modelled. Exit interviews point to fee confusion rather than service quality. Revenue impact is contained at present, but retention costs are rising faster than forecast. Please review the attached cohort tables carefully before our call. The strategic implications are summarised in the confidential note below.

management briefing: The renewal with Zoraelax Group closes at $10 million a year, 15 percent below the last contract. Project Ralael slips by six weeks because of the audit delay.

TICKET FV-2291 — Signature check failed on Castwright feed validator v3.4.1

Deploy blocked at the verification gate. The validator binary was built on the Pinebrook runner after Tuesday's rotation, but the release pipeline still holds the retired public key, so every artifact fails verification. Rebuilds won't help. Release manager action: update the trusted keyset in the gate config, then re-trigger the promote job. Rotation ticket is closed; the replacement is live. The current signing key is below.

signing key of bagap-yawep = bky13_TbfT6ZMUoGJo2